
Discover Fryton
Fryton is a small village located in North Yorkshire, England, with a population of 45. Situated within the YO62 postcode area, it is governed by North Yorkshire Council (formerly Ryedale). Though modest in size, Fryton is part of a region known for its scenic landscapes and proximity to the North York Moors National Park.
